The KMS 104 Plus brings studio sound quality to the stage. It is equipped with a true condenser microphone capsule offering the superior clarity that made Neumann studio microphones famous all over the world. At the same time, the KMS 104 Plus possesses the ruggedness required of a stage mic, thus refuting the myth that condenser microphones must be "fragile". The KMS 104 Plus can withstand enormous sound pressure levels of up to 150 dB without clipping, and its tight cardioid pattern ensures high gain before feedback. The KMS 104 Plus has a much smoother frequency response than dynamic microphones and an airy top-end. Compared to dynamic microphones, the Neumann KMS 104 Plus has a vastly superior transient response resulting in a more immediate and emotional vocal sound. This results in effortless intelligibility, without the usual EQ boosts for further improved feedback resistance. Choose this microphone in black or nickel finish.

As a stage microphone, the KMS 104 Plus is optimized for close miking; a fixed low cut filter compensates for the proximity effect and ensures clear bass. Compared to the KMS 104 the KMS 104 Plus gives added emphasis to the lower register (100-150 Hz), lending more "weight" and "warmth" to voices which might sound too "light" with the KMS 104. The Plus version is particularly popular with female singers.

The headgrille is made of hardened steel and features a highly effective internal pop screen which also keeps moisture away from the capsule. Thanks to careful Neumann engineering, these acoustic filters do not cause any sibilance problems. The head amplifier is protected by a thick-walled housing. Its transformerless output minimizes electromagnetic interference, such as hum. Because of its low output impedance of only 50 ohms, the KMS 104 plus can drive very long cable runs of up to 300 m (1000 ft) without transmission losses.

Primarily designed as a handheld vocal microphone, the KMS 104 Plus can be used for other stage applications as well, due to its high SPL capability and wide dynamic range. Examples include percussion, saxophone, trumpet, trombone, harmonica, acoustic guitar, and guitar cabinets. The KMS 104 plus is also a superb microphone for home recording and broadcast applications. As the KMS 104 plus is optimized for close mic placement, it will pick up a dry sound with very little ambience, which is a big advantage in untreated rooms.

  • Transducer TypeCondenser
  • Polar PatternCardioid/cardioid/supercardioid
  • Frequency Range20 Hz - 20 kHz
  • Rated Output Impedance50 ohms
  • Sensitivity at 1 kHz into 1 kohm4.5 mV/Pa
  • Equivalent noise level, CCIR1)28 dB
  • Equivalent noise level, A-weighted1)18 dB-A
  • Signal-to-noise ratio, CCIR1) (rel. 94 dB SPL)66 dB
  • Signal-to-noise ratio, A-weighted1) (rel. 94 dB SPL)76 dB
  • Maximum SPL for THD 0.5%2)150 dB
  • Maximum output voltage12 dBu
  • Supply voltage (P48, IEC 1938)48 V ± 4 V
  • Current consumption (P48, IEC 1938)3.5 mA
  • Matching connectorXLR3F
  • Weightapprox. 300 g
  • Diameter48 mm
  • Length180 mm
  • Note
    • 1) according to IEC 60268-1; CCIR-weighting acccording to CCIR 468-3, quasi peak; A-weighting according to IEC 61672-1, RMS
    • 2) measured as equivalent el. input signal
